The summer festival season is the gift that keeps on giving, with the announcement that Sunset Sounds will return in 2018, boasting one heck of a line-up.

The program will be spread out over three weekends in January, featuring acts such as Saskwatch, The Bamboos, Alexander Biggs, The Hot Potato Band and more.

All Sunset Sounds events are entirely free, with the tunes being backed up with a host of Melbourne’s favourite food trucks.

City of Stonnington Mayor Cr Steve Stefanopoulos said the annual event will showcases the beauty of Melbourne during the summer.

“Stonnington has some of the most sensational parks and gardens, and it brings me great joy to see residents and visitors enjoying them” Stefanopoulos said.

“Pack a picnic basket, and your dancing shoes, and head down for a summers afternoon with some of Australia’s finest talent.”
